Appendix A Additional Configuration Methods, Parameters, and Procedures Collecting Information for Troubleshooting Step 2 Step 3 On the server that will receive information, open a command window and type the following command: prserv [listen-port] where listen_port is the same port that you specified with the Nprintf parameter. If you do not specify a port, 9001 is used by default. While pserv is running, information from the Cisco IP Phone is sent to a file named listen-port.log, where listen-port is the port you specified with the Nprintf parameter and the prserv command. This file is stored on the server you specified with the Nprintf parameter in the folder from which you ran the preserv command. If the file exists, new information is appended to it. You can open a listen-port.log file using a text editor. To exit prserv.exe and stop collecting information, press Ctrl-C in the command window.
